Thank you for the inquiry regarding the load limit sticker on your Novara Safari bike.

We posed your question regarding the perceived difference between the description of the bike on REI.com and the load limit sticker on the frame to the Novara technical services team.

Novara's direct written response was as follows: "Thanks for bringing this to our attention. Novara doesn't feel there is a discrepancy between the terrain warning on the category use sticker (the one on the bike frame) and the product information online. The next level up (i.e. going from 1+ to 2) specifically calls out "vertical dropsē such as those associated with traditional mountain biking which isn't the intended purpose of the Safari. I agree the word 'smooth' is very open to interpretation, but that's currently within the organizations interpretation.

We will ask if we can asterisk the words "heavy load" with the comment "subject to bike weight limit of 250lbs."
